Chinese giant CATL, the world's largest manufacturer of electric vehicle batteries, is set to produce its first sodium batteries in large quantities later this year. Let's go back to that revolution that made a noise: batteries without lithium!
Almost all electric cars in the world use lithium-ion batteries.
This chemistry is perfected and controlled in terms of production, but it is also relatively inexpensive given the large quantities currently available. Not everything is perfect, and delamination of lithium in batteries may become necessary in the future. CATL seems to have a solution with the available sodium-based batteries. With several kilograms of lithium available in each electric vehicle battery, this chemical content is very important to every manufacturers. The dilemma is that the two largest producers, Chile and Australia, are far from their battery production plants.
Thus, the environmental and climate impact of lithium is very real, as it must be transported thousands of kilometers before it can be used in a battery.
In addition, lithium mining conditions can have a negative impact on the environmental climate, particularly due to the large supplies of water needed for lithium mines. But even then, an electric car is still "purer" than a combustion engine car.

Another lithium problem is the risk of a scarcity in the coming years, as announced by Toyota or Germany recently.
Therefore, the solution of using sodium - an element that is least deficient on the planet - is an excellent solution, but so far the energy density of sodium-ion batteries has been too deficient to be efficient enough in electric vehicles.
CATL reported several months ago that it was working on sodium-ion batteries in the lab, with a promise for the future that would interest all future electric vehicle buyers: batteries that are much cheaper.

Today we understand that lithium alternatives, such as sodium-ion batteries, will be produced by CATL at a time to be determined in 2023. This means that the first vehicles equipped with such batteries will hit the roads at the beginning of 2024, with good benefits. and the disadvantages that this brings. . In addition to these sodium-ion batteries, CATL's Qilin battery will be mass-produced in the first quarter of 2023, the latter with recharging in the blink of an eye and a range that easily surpasses current batteries: a range of 1000 km and a recharge in 10 minutes. This battery is found in Geely's Zeekr 001.
